Lawler decked by food poisoning

By Dayton Morinaga
Advertiser Staff Writer

Robbie Lawler had to fold, but Renato "Charuto" Verissimo and Scott Junk showed winning hands in the Icon Sport: All In mixed martial arts card last night.

A crowd of around 2,500 at the Blaisdell Center Arena watched Verissimo and Junk make successful debuts in the Icon Sport organization.

The scheduled main event between Robbie Lawler of Iowa and Trevor Garrett of Ohio was canceled because Lawler was suffering from food poisoning.

Icon Sport president T. Jay Thompson said Lawler will remain the No. 1 contender in the middleweight division (185 pounds), and could get a title shot against champion Frank Trigg in March or April.

"This doesn't change anything, it's just something unfortunate," Thompson said. "We're still looking at Robbie against Frank, if we can work it out."

Verissimo may also soon be in title contention in the middleweight division based on his impressive victory over Kris Fleurestil last night. Verissimo worked Fleurestil to the ground, and then unleashed a series of unanswered punches, prompting the referee to stop the bout, 2 minutes, 19 seconds into the first round.

"I probably need one more fight to get ready," he said. "But I feel satisfied."

Junk scored one of the fastest knockouts in Icon Sport history, dropping John George with a straight right hand, 10 seconds into the heavyweight bout.

"I just turned my hips and my hand snapped right on his chin," Junk said.

In another bout, Bronson Pieper of Wai'anae defeated Chico Cantiberos by first-round knockout to win the state championship in the 145-pound class.

OTHER RESULTS

205 pounds: Jeremy Williams def. Derek Thornton by choke submission, 1:48 first round. 170: Mark Moreno def. Sam Jackson by KO kick, 0:24 first round. 150: Jerome Kekumu def. Mike Balasi by split decision. Heavyweight: Randy Lueder def. Ron Fields by unanimous decision. 195: Kala Kolohe Hose def. Kekoa Baker by TKO punches, 1:10 first round. 145: Sadhu Bott def. Peni Taufa'ao by rear-naked choke, 1:24 second round. 160: Justin Bucholz def. Brandon Pieper by TKO punches, 1:53 first round. Heavyweight: Richard Desforge def. Allen Lau by TKO punches, 1:33 second round. 140: Devon Chong def. Isaiah Cobb-Adams by armbar submission, 1:40 first round.
